Abstract: A process for monitoring a 5G data and telephone network can include starting a first instance and a second instance of a network function in a virtual private cloud (VPC). The first instance uses a first user account, and the second instance uses a second user account. A first log includes entries associated with the first instance in response to activities of the first user account. A second log includes entries associated with the second instance in response to activities of the second user account. The first log and second log go to a log destination of a centralized cloud account. A data stream comprising transformed data from the log destination goes into a bucket associated with the centralized cloud account. A query selects a data set from the bucket that includes attributes associated with network activities of the first and second user accounts.

Abstract: Methods and systems are provided for service policy orchestration in a communication network. Orchestrating a service policy in a communication network may include, receiving first service event related data, with the first service event related data including data that defines an update of a current service execution policy; selecting an operator access domain linked to the first service event related data for executing a service linked to the service policy; sending to the operator access domain the first service event related data and an operator specific service identifier linked to a respective operator access domain; receiving first feedback data set from the operator access domain; and processing the first feedback data set.

Abstract: An example method for a programmable infrastructure gateway for enabling hybrid cloud services in a network environment is provided and includes receiving an instruction from a hybrid cloud application executing in a private cloud, interpreting the instruction according to a hybrid cloud application programming interface, and executing the interpreted instruction in a public cloud using a cloud adapter. The method is generally executed in the infrastructure gateway including a programmable integration framework allowing generation of various cloud adapters using a cloud adapter software development kit, the cloud adapter being generated and programmed to be compatible with a specific public cloud platform of the public cloud. In specific embodiments, identical copies of the infrastructure gateway can be provided to different cloud service providers who manage disparate public cloud platforms; each copy of the infrastructure gateway can be programmed differently to generate corresponding cloud adapters compatible with the respective public cloud platforms.
